what is the name for the protective structure that forms around the embryo

Amniotic cavity is the term used for the sac which protects an embryo from internal and external pressures. It contains the amniotic fluid which serves as the cushion for guarding the developing embryo and the system to which it is being fed on. It is a crucial part of pregnancy to be able to take tests in diagnosing the fetus for possible defects and abnormalities and one of the methods used is the amniocentesis wherein samples of the amniotic fluid are sampled.
